Rev. Shawn Conoboy '02, Ph.D., Appointed to Vatican Position

Congratulations are in order for Rev. Shawn Conoboy '02, Ph.D., whose distinguished career in priestly service has now reached the Vatican. Father Conoboy has accepted an appointment to the staff of the Vatican's Dicastery for Promoting Integral Human Development, an honor that reflects both his scholarly accomplishments and his deep pastoral commitment. While Father Conoboy remains a priest of the Diocese of Youngstown, The Most Reverend David J. Bonnar has proudly released him for this special assignment, recognizing the significance of his contributions to the universal Church.

At the Dicastery, Father Conoboy will serve in the section that works with Bishops' Conferences around the world to identify and address the material needs of local churches. This work aligns perfectly with his lifelong dedication to pastoral ministry with the most vulnerable. The Dicastery's mission, to help fulfill Christ's promise that "all may have life to the full", encompasses crucial questions of economy, health, migration, ecology, and peace. Father Conoboy's responsibilities will include supporting action plans to resolve complex issues facing God's people globally.

The appointment represents a well-earned recognition of Father Conoboy's exceptional preparation and gifts. He earned his Ph.D. in Systematic Theology from Duquesne University in December 2021 and holds advanced theological degrees from the Pontifical Gregorian University in Rome and the Teresianum, Pontifical Institute for Spirituality. Throughout his priesthood, which began with his ordination in 2006, Father Conoboy has distinguished himself through parish leadership, ecumenical dialogue, interfaith work, and service to migrant communities demonstrating the very integral human development the Dicastery promotes.

Bishop Bonnar expressed his enthusiasm for Father Conoboy's new chapter, “Father Conoboy’s appointment is a great honor, not only for him, but for the Diocese of Youngstown. Father Conoboy has so many gifts as a priest and theologian, and I am excited that he will now be using those gifts in his work with the Holy Father and the dicastery’s staff, led by Cardinal Michael Czerny, Sister Alessandra Smerilli, and Father Fabio Baggio. While we will miss him during his time of service to the Vatican, I give thanks that the Holy Spirit has opened up this new way for Father Conoboy to use his gifts for the good of the universal Church. Upon the completion of his duties, we will welcome him back with open arms." The Ave Maria community joins the Diocese of Youngstown in celebrating this remarkable achievement by one of our own.
